Royal Numismatic Society is a learned society and charity based in London, United Kingdom which promotes research into all branches of numismatics. It was founded in 1836 as the Numismatic Society of London and received the title of the Royal Numismatic Society by Royal Charter in 1904. Its present patron is HM The Queen. Its lectures and publications deal with classical, Asian, medieval and modern coins, paper money, tokens and medals. Fellows are nominated then elected and are entitled to use the post-nominal letters "FRNS" after their names. [edit] PublicationsThe Numismatic Chronicle is the annual publication of the Royal Numismatic Society. A decade index is published in every tenth volume, and the most recent decade index is on the Royal Numismatic Society website. [edit] External links
